A number of Manchester City fans have reacted excitedly to transfer reports linking them with a potential summer move for Ferran Torres.
Spanish media outlet Super Deporte reported that the Valencia winger is top of Pep Guardiola’s shortlist in terms of transfer targets for that position, ahead of Kingsley Coman, Adama Traore and Leon Bailey, amid continuing speculation surrounding Leroy Sane’s future. The 20-year-old has made 35 appearances for Valencia this season, with six goals and seven assists to his name, contributing two of each in their Champions League campaign. In a similar vein to Bernardo Silva, he is primarily a right winger but can also be deployed on the left flank, from where he has contributed a few goals. [via TransferMarkt]
The youngster also starred for Spain in their European Under-19 Championship triumph last year, scoring both goals in their victory over Portugal in the final while also netting in the semi-finals against France. [via Marca]
